Greek industrial turnover index up 20.9 pct in Feb
- Written by E.Tsiliopoulos
Greek general turnover index in the industrial sector (measuring both the domestic and external markets) rose 20.9 pct in February this year compared with the same month in 2016, after a 14.6 pct decline recorded in the 2016/2015 period, Hellenic Statistical Authority said on Thursday.
The statistics service, in a monthly report, said this development was the result of a 10.6 pct increase in the mining turnover index and a 21.1 pct rise in the manufacturing turnover index. The domestic market turnover index rose 17.3 pct and the external market index was up 25.8 pct. The general index rose 6.5 pct in February from January 2017.
